Heads-up on the Tilegrub prefetcher job: it flakes when the fixture server starts slower than the worker pool. Before filing anything, check that the warmup stage logged all twelve region manifests; if any are missing, the prefetch counts will be off by exactly one batch. Retry once with the cache cleared — a second identical failure is real. When you escalate, include the trace token printed at the end of the run, shown here.

pipeline stamp: htk9_ce63042d9

The nightly export job occasionally fails on upstream timeouts from the Farrowgate warehouse API. Failed batches land in the retry queue, where a worker re-attempts them with exponential backoff — three tries, then dead-letter. Please check the dead-letter count each morning before 10:00; anything older than 48 hours needs manual replay via the admin console. Do not change backoff parameters without looping in Priya's replacement on the platform team. For reference, the retry worker currently runs with these configuration values.

settings of kajep-kawip:
[zorys]
host = zorys.urlaqgrid.corp
user = zorys_svc
database = zorys_prod

Facilities Ticket #— Storage Room B-07 (Spare Hardware)

New starters: spare laptops, docks, and cabling for the Pellwick programme are kept in Storage Room B-07, basement level, beside the goods lift. Take only what your onboarding sheet lists, record each item in the clipboard log on the shelf, and close the door firmly — it doesn't latch on its own. The room is alarmed outside 08:00–18:00. Entry is via the keypad using the code provided below.

turnstile pass: bdg-QZV-3